Aaron’s name will forever be linked to one of the most famous records in sports. When he broke Babe Ruth’s long-standing career home run record, it was far more than a statistical event. It was a moment filled with sporting significance, emotional weight, and historical meaning. Almost no athlete has ever pursued such a visible record under such intense pressure. Even in the middle of that historic tension, he stayed true to himself, steady in approach and extraordinary in performance.

No honest account of Aaron’s life can ignore the hardship he endured away from the game itself. During the most visible chapter of his career, he endured ugly prejudice and hostility while remaining composed. The pressure of public attention was severe enough on its own, yet he also carried the cruelty of bigotry. The fact that he kept going with strength and restraint under such circumstances is one of the clearest measures of his character. He stood for more than athletic accomplishment; he came to represent resolve and dignity in the face of hatred.
